Visibility Management
Introduction
Visibility Management in cybersecurity refers to the processes and tools used to gain comprehensive insight into an organization's IT environment. This encompasses the monitoring, detection, and analysis of network traffic, endpoints, and user activities to identify potential threats and ensure compliance with security policies. Effective visibility management is crucial for maintaining robust security postures and enabling swift incident response.
Core Mechanisms
Visibility Management is underpinned by several core mechanisms that work together to provide a holistic view of the IT environment:
- Network Traffic Analysis: Monitoring and analyzing data packets traversing the network to identify unusual patterns or unauthorized access attempts.
- Endpoint Monitoring: Deploying agents on devices to track their activities and status, ensuring they adhere to security protocols.
- User Activity Monitoring: Logging user actions to detect insider threats or compromised accounts.
- Log Management: Collecting and analyzing logs from various systems and applications to identify anomalies.
- Threat Intelligence Integration: Leveraging external threat data to enhance detection capabilities and anticipate potential attacks.
Attack Vectors
Visibility Management helps mitigate several attack vectors by providing critical insights into the IT environment. Common attack vectors include:
- Phishing Attacks: Identifying suspicious email patterns that could lead to credential theft.
- Malware Infections: Detecting unusual file executions or network connections indicative of malware.
- Insider Threats: Monitoring user behavior to identify unauthorized access to sensitive data.
- Advanced Persistent Threats (APTs): Recognizing subtle, long-term intrusion attempts that traditional defenses might miss.
Defensive Strategies
Implementing effective Visibility Management involves several defensive strategies:
- Unified Security Information and Event Management (SIEM): Integrating logs and alerts from various sources to provide a centralized view of security events.
- Automated Threat Detection: Using AI and machine learning to identify and respond to threats in real-time.
- Regular Audits and Assessments: Conducting periodic reviews of visibility tools and processes to ensure they remain effective.
- Network Segmentation: Isolating critical assets to limit the lateral movement of threats.
- User Training and Awareness: Educating employees on security best practices to reduce the risk of human error.
Real-World Case Studies
- Target Corporation Data Breach (2013): Lack of visibility into network activities allowed attackers to exfiltrate credit card data from over 40 million customers.
- Equifax Data Breach (2017): Failure to monitor and patch vulnerable systems led to the compromise of sensitive information of 147 million individuals.
- Capital One Data Breach (2019): Insufficient visibility into cloud configurations enabled a former employee to exploit a misconfigured web application firewall.
Architecture Diagram
The following diagram illustrates a typical architecture of Visibility Management in a corporate network:
Conclusion
Visibility Management is a critical component of modern cybersecurity strategies. By providing a comprehensive view of the IT environment, it enables organizations to detect, respond to, and mitigate threats more effectively. As cyber threats continue to evolve, maintaining robust visibility into all aspects of the network and user activities will remain a top priority for security professionals.